The Cagiva Elefant 200 was a two-stroke, single-cylinder motorcycle produced in 1985-86. It had a liquid-cooled engine with a capacity of 190 cc and a compression ratio of 11.9:1. The bike had both kick and electric starting, and could produce a maximum power of 27 horsepower at 9000 rpm and a maximum torque of 21 Nm at 7500 rpm. It had a six-speed transmission and a chain final drive. The chassis was a tubular duplex cradle design, with telescopic forks in the front and an alloy single shock soft damp suspension in the rear. It had a single 240mm disc brake in the front and a 130mm drum brake in the rear. The front and rear tyres measured 3.00-21 and 4.60-17 respectively. The bike weighed 125 kg and had a fuel capacity of 15.5 litres or approximately 4.0 US gallons.
Make Model: Cagiva Elefant 200
Year: 1985 – 86
Engine: Two stroke, single cylinder
Capacity: 190 cc / 11.6 cu-in
Bore x Stroke: 67 x 54 mm
Cooling System: Liquid cooled
Compression Ratio: 11.9:1
Induction: Single Dell’Orto premix
Ignition: Electronic
Starting: Kick & Electric
Max Power: 27 hp / 19.7 @ 9000 rpm
Max Torque: 21 Nm / 15.4 lb-ft @ 7500 rpm
Transmission: 6 Speed
Final Drive: Chain
Frame: Tubular duplex cradle
Front Suspension: Telescopic forks
Rear Suspension: Alloy single shock soft damp
Front Brakes: Single 240mm disc
Rear Brakes: 130mm Drum
Front Tyre: 3.00-21
Rear Tyre: 4.60-17
Dry Weight: 125 kg / 275.5 lbs
Fuel Capacity: 15.5 Litres / 4.0 US gal
